Pozole with Pinto Beans and Queso Fresco

View Recipe

Pozole, which translates to hominy, refers to one of the key ingredients in this traditional Mexican food recipe. To boost the flavor complexity, start by roasting the tomatillos, peppers, onions, and garlic for 15 minutes before blending and adding to the soup base. Add the chicken, hominy, and pinto beans; simmer until warm; and serve with piles of fresh herbs, pickled onions, and cheese.

Huaraches con Carnitas

View Recipe

27 Must-Try Mexican Recipes (17)

Due to their shoelace appearance, these toasty Mexican sandwiches are called huaraches, which translates to sandals. Made with masa harina, the crispy fried bread holds classic carnitas and all your favorite Mexican toppings. To complement the rich shredded pork, top each open-face sandwich with a crisp and refreshing Mexican salad recipe of shredded cabbage, tomato, avocado, and crema.

Steak al Carbon

View Recipe

27 Must-Try Mexican Recipes (23)

Cooking over coals is imperative to make this Mexican beef recipe fit the al carbon (meaning cooked over charcoal) agenda. So bust out your grill, or your trusty grill pan, to sear these marinated steaks for a lovely low-carb dinner. After the steaks are done cooking, allow them to rest for 5 to 10 minutes as you char some grilled vegetables to serve on the side.
